The archaeological world and international community are in mourning as the Iraqi government announced Thursday that Islamic State (ISIS) jihadists had leveled the remains of the ancient city of Nimrud, a priceless archaeological site considered a major treasure of Assyrian civilization.

The headless corpse of Mansour Saad Awad, an Egyptian Christian, has been found by Libyan security forces on the outskirts of the town of Mechili, in eastern Libya. The victim of the barbaric murder worked in a poultry farm in the area. No one has yet stepped forward to take credit for the slaying, but the m.o. matches the preferred execution style of the Islamic State (ISIS).
